Lonza Tampa, is looking to hire a Manager of Manufacturing to manage the daily activities of Manufacturing Team(s). This leadership role ensures that all cGMP Manufacturing Equipment is validated, and the cGMP batch records are executed in a compliant fashion. This role is closely involved with the technical and regulatory aspects of all assigned projects from inception to completion. In addition, this role is expected to support and lead manufacturing operations in the absence of the Operation Head and as needed.
Key Accountabilities:
Read, write, understand and train the Operations Department on Standard Operating Procedures (SOP's)
Coordinate activities in the manufacturing space with other departments
Accountable for the results of a team of professional individual contributors. The subordinate group will generally possess a wide variety of skills and/or knowledge, performing somewhat complex to very complex tasks.
Provides work direction and leadership to ensure that team is compliant with all current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P).
Preparation, execution and follow up for customer audits and regulatory inspections.
Participates in investigations into minor and major root cause, corrective or preventive actions and impact to product safety, identity, strength, quality or purity.
Assists in the development, implementation of process measurement and monitoring system.
Selects, develops and evaluates professional individual contributors to ensure the efficient operation of the team.
Review Master Batch Records and executed batch records.
Hire, train and develop staff
Ensure proper validation of all cGMP manufacturing equipment
Attend all applicable meetings, discussions, etc in support of related projects
Maintain a positive, professional, and confidential relationship with clients
Adhere to all defined Safety and Sustainability requirements and expectations and seek clarification whenever Safety and Sustainability requirements and expectations are either unknown or unclear
Promptly report identified Safety and Sustainability issues, problems, deficiencies, errors, incidents, and/or opportunities to management and correct where possible
Assist with managing the manufacturing activities within an area of a site to ensure products are manufactured safely, on-schedule and within quality standards and cost objectives.
Assists in the development of departmental plans, including production and/or organizational priorities. Adapts departmental plans and priorities to address resource and operational challenges.
Monitors production processes and the effective use of resources and equipment.
Key Requirements:
A Bachelor's degree in a Science field is required.
A minimum of 10 years of experience as a leader or in a management position is required.
Pharma cGMP Experience is required.
